Job Requirements / Description
SummaryResponsible for designing and implementing a multi-sensory individualized educational plan (IEP) for each child in a self-contained classroom with up to 12 students or up to 14 students in high school; and maintaining a classroom environment that is conducive to effective individual diagnosis, prescription, correction, and evaluation.Job DutiesReviews prior records of students in order to identify specific educational needs.Participates in IEP meetings to develop an educational plan that supports the student's therapeutic program; periodically assesses and reports accomplishments relative to IEP.Works cooperatively within the multi-disciplinary milieu, therapeutic treatment setting with psychologists, child care staff, parents, various therapists, and others to develop, implement, and facilitate each student's overall treatment plan and IEP.Administers formal and informal assessments to determine baseline levels of functioning and measure student progress.Utilizes current teaching methods and strategies to design lesson plans that engage students in the learning process; ensures opportunities for all students to actively participate; assigns homework that can be accomplished independently.Prepares weekly lesson plans for Principal review; ensures plans are detailed for substitute staff to follow in the event of absence; ensures lessons comply with local school district course of study and California State Frameworks.Develops and implements effective behavior management techniques appropriate for students with autism and consistent with the Agency's therapeutic and positive reinforcement philosophies; maintains a structured, organized, and safe educational environment with posted classroom rules and schedules; models appropriate behaviors.Develops and maintains individual and classroom records including progress reports, daily attendance records, formal educational assessments, and transcripts in accordance with school policies; ensures confidentiality is maintained; prepares daily student evaluation reports relative to academic and behavioral performance for use by child care staff, parents, and others when working with the student after school.Counsels students on classes required to meet graduation standards, as appropriate.Participates in Student Study Team to identify ways to remediate and enrich academic learning and behavioral growth for each student.Physical RequirementsIn the course of performing this job, the incumbent typically spends time standing, walking on sloped/hilly areas of campus, carrying, driving, lifting (up to 40 pounds), listening, speaking, reaching, writing, and participating in restraint procedures.Minimum RequirementsSpecial Education Credential or credential eligible.Demonstrated skill in working with children with autism.Demonstrated skill in behavior management.Demonstrated skill in curriculum development.Ability to pass and utilize Therapeutic Crisis Intervention (CPI) within three months of hire.Ability to pass and utilize First Aid and CPR certification within three months of hire.Very effective oral and written communications. #J-18808-Ljbffr
